## Deployment: Cold Storage Archival

New to the Brindlevault team? Read this first. Archival moves buckets older than 180 days from warm tier to glacier-class storage. The archiver runs as a cron pod in the ops cluster; one replica only, or you get duplicate manifests. Always dry-run before a real sweep. Manifests land in the audit bucket and must be retained for two years. Rollback is restore-from-manifest; it is slow, so don't archive anything flagged active. The archiver pod loads its configuration from the values below.

settings of yaguf-bahip:
druwyn:
  log_level: debug
  metrics_host: metrics.druwyn.qorvelsys.internal
  pool_size: 32

Subject: Key rotation — Shelfwright catalogue import

Per the rotation schedule, the ingest credential for Shelfwright, the library catalogue import service, was rotated at 09:00 today. Scope unchanged: write access to the catalogue staging index only. Old key revoked in 24 hours. No other credentials affected. Audit log entries for the rotation are available in the usual vault history view; please confirm scope and expiry as part of your review. Downstream consumers have been notified. New key for verification purposes follows:

service key, fawip-bajef: kto11_Qt5wZK9vdNC

Quick heads-up on the loading dock at Fennick & Hale. Couriers can deliver between 7:30am and 3pm on weekdays only — anything arriving after that gets turned away, and trust us, the drivers will try their luck. If someone shows up outside hours, point them to the overnight locker by Gate C and log it in the Dockbook. Big pallets need a warning to facilities a day ahead. To open the dock shutter for drivers, you'll use the pass code below.

badge for fafop-fajof: bdg-Z-47

## Offline Mode: Limits and Quotas

Fieldnote Surveyor caches forms, photos, and GPS traces locally when a crew loses signal, then syncs when connectivity returns. To protect device storage and the sync backend, offline mode enforces hard quotas: a cap on queued submissions, a per-photo size ceiling, and a maximum offline duration before the app forces a reconciliation. Support should quote these numbers exactly when troubleshooting stuck uploads. The enforced limits, as defined in the client config, are below.

constants for bagaf-hadup:
QUOTAS = {
    "quenael": 1,
    "ralwyn": 1,
    "oliath": 2,
    "ulaael": 2,
}